Prizehog BWX State Com #1H Reached 1,127 Boepd, 89% Liquids on 4,720 Foot Lateral

SAN ANTONIO, Nov. 28,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- Lilis Energy, Inc. LLEX, an exploration and development company operating in the Permian Basin of West Texas, announced today that the Prizehog BWX State Com #1H reached a 24-hour initial production rate of 1,127 Boepd on a three-stream basis, at 239 Boepd per 1,000 ft or 170 Bopd per 1,000 ft of lateral. The well currently is producing at 89% liquids with 71% oil on a three-stream basis.

The Prizehog BWX State Com #1H is Lilis's sixth successful operating horizontal Wolfcamp B well in the Permian's Delaware Basin.  The Prizehog #1H's 4,720 ft lateral was completed with 24 stages of 200 ft plug-to-plug spacing with approximately 2,040 lbs. of sand per ft.  More importantly, this well is an additional data point that further delineates the Company's eastern most acreage. 

The Company plans to continue developing its New Mexico acreage with two additional wells scheduled in the first quarter of 2018.  The Company expects that it will likely target the Wolfcamp A formation for these wells.   In addition, the Company also plans to continue delineating its acreage geographically to the east and drilling additional benches in its Texas properties in the coming months.

The Company also announced gas sales for the Company's New Mexico properties commenced through its agreement with Lucid on November 16, 2017.  Lilis anticipates initial Texas production by December 15, 2017 and anticipates completed field production across all of its properties dedicated to Lucid by mid-January 2018. 

"We are extremely pleased with the results from the Prizehog BWX State Com #1H.  This well is further evidence of the significant productivity and potential of our eastern acreage.  We intend to continue delineating our acreage both geographically and geologically through testing of additional benches in upcoming wells.  We are also very pleased to see the initial gas sales under our new midstream partnership with Lucid," said Ron Ormand, Executive Chairman of Lilis.

About Lilis Energy, Inc.

Lilis Energy, Inc. is a San Antonio-based independent oil and gas exploration and production company that operates in the Permian's Delaware Basin, considered amongst the leading resource plays in North America.  Lilis's total net acreage in the Permian Basin is over 15,000 acres.  Lilis Energy's near-term E&P focus is to grow current reserves and production and pursue strategic acquisitions in its core areas.  For more information, please visit www.lilisenergy.com.
